Chipper Jones was a guest analyst on Fox Sports Southeast's broadcast of Atlanta's 4-0 win over St. Louis Wednesday at SunTrust Park.

The Hall of Fame Brave was present for Austin Riley's debut — capped by Riley's fourth-inning home run.

Jones talked about Riley’s hitting, his prospects at third and left field (two positions Jones played in Atlanta).
